Where is my KentOne student ID card?

Before you arrive 

As part of the enrolment process, you will need to upload a passport-style photo that must meet these specific requirements. This photo will be on your KentOne student ID card for the whole period of your studies and cannot be changed.

Collecting your KentOne student ID card

Canterbury campus

You can collect your KentOne student ID card from Friday 13 September from the Arrivals Hub, which is situated in the Templeman Library. Please allow 48 hours between receiving your Registration confirmation email and going to collect your ID card.

Medway campus

During Welcome Week (Mon 16 to Fri 20 September), you can collect your KentOne student ID card from the Oasis Lounge (open 10.00-16.00), in the Rochester building. From Monday 23 September, you can collect your KentOne student ID card from the Medway Student Administration reception in the Medway building.

Kent and Medway Medical School students

We will produce your KMMS student ID card and hand it out to you during Welcome Week.


Please allow 48 hours between receiving your Registration confirmation email and going to collect your ID card.   

Are you sponsored on a Student visa?

If you require a Biometric Residence Permit (BRP) to study in the UK, you will be contacted by the Student Immigration Compliance Team to arrange the collection of your student ID card from the Arrivals Hub (Canterbury) or the Gillingham building reception (Medway).

Post Office Biometric Residence Permit (BRP) collection

If you have collected your BRP from the Post Office, you must bring this in person to the Arrivals Hub (Canterbury) or the Medway building reception (Medway) so that we can take a copy for your student record. This must be done before the registration deadline. You will not be registered until you have presented both your passport and BRP to us.

Your KentOne photo must:

  • be a recent close-up colour photo of your head and shoulders against a white background
  • not be cropped
  • show you dressed appropriately
  • not include any filters
  • be between 1 to 100kb in size, preferably with the dimensions of 286 (horizontal) X 388 (vertical) pixels, and no greater than 500 by 500 pixels. The file name does not matter, as long as it is in .jpg format.
